Understanding Google Play Services
Google Play Services is a background service that plays a crucial role in the functioning of Android devices. It supports multiple applications by providing core features, including authentication, location services, and app updates. Understanding its responsibilities helps clarify why it consumes significant battery power.
Core Functions of Google Play Services
- Authentication: Google Play Services manages sign-ins for apps, simplifying user access to Google accounts.
- Location Services: It provides location data to apps, utilizing GPS and Wi-Fi networks, which can drain the battery when active.
- App Updates: Automatic updates for Google apps ensure you receive the latest features and security patches, but this process can also impact battery life.
Reasons for High Battery Consumption
- Background Activity: Frequent background activity for location tracking or syncing can lead to increased battery use. Apps relying on real-time updates often pull information regularly.
- Multiple App Dependencies: Many apps rely on Google Play Services for critical functionalities. If several apps use the service simultaneously, overall battery consumption rises.
- Settings Configuration: Certain settings, like high-accuracy mode for location services, demand more resources and can increase battery drain.
Managing Battery Usage
To reduce battery consumption associated with Google Play Services, follow these practical steps:
- Adjust Location Settings:
- Go to Settings > Location.
- Choose Battery Saving mode for less GPS reliance.
- Limit Background Data:
- Navigate to Settings > Apps > Google Play Services.
- Select Mobile Data and disable background data.
- Update Apps:
- Ensure all apps are updated, as developers often optimize performance and battery usage.
- Clear Cache:
- Access Settings > Apps > Google Play Services.
- Tap Storage and select Clear Cache.
Monitoring Battery Usage
You can track which apps are draining your battery by going to Settings > Battery > Battery Usage. Here, you’ll see a breakdown of battery consumption by each app, including Google Play Services. Understanding which apps consume more power allows you to make informed decisions about app usage.

Common Reasons for High Battery Usage
High battery usage by Google Play Services often stems from a few common factors. Understanding these can help you manage your device’s power consumption effectively.
Background Sync and Updates
Google Play Services continuously syncs data in the background, which can drain your battery. This includes updating apps, syncing contacts, and managing notifications. Frequent syncing increases power consumption. To minimize this, consider adjusting your sync settings. Limit the number of apps that sync data or choose manual sync instead.





Location Services
Location services tied to Google Play Services can consume substantial battery life. Tracking location for weather apps, maps, or ride-sharing applications uses GPS and network resources. Tightening your location settings can help reduce usage. Switch to “Battery saving” mode instead of “High accuracy,” or turn off location access for apps that don’t need it.
Fetching Data in the Background
Fetching data in the background contributes significantly to battery drain. Apps that constantly pull information, like email or social media apps, increase this load. Review background data settings for various apps. Disable background app activity for apps that you don’t need to receive updates from constantly. You can also set specific times for data fetching to limit continuous power draw.
Troubleshooting Google Play Services Battery Drain
Managing battery drain caused by Google Play Services involves several practical steps. You can implement these actions to minimize impact on your device’s power consumption.
Checking App Permissions
Review app permissions regularly to identify which apps access sensitive features. Some apps may continue to use Google Play Services excessively if permissions are broad.





- Open Settings on your device.
- Tap Apps or Application Manager.
- Select Google Play Services.
- Tap Permissions to view the list.
- Disable permissions that are not necessary for the functioning of apps.
Limiting permissions for non-essential apps reduces background activity and potentially lowers battery usage.
Disabling Unnecessary Features
Step back and evaluate features enabled on your device. Turning off features not in use can significantly conserve battery life.
- Open Settings.
- Go to Location.
- Select Mode and switch to Battery saving or Device only.
- Navigate to Network & internet, then Data usage, and disable Background data for certain apps.
Disabling background data stops apps from using Google Play Services when you’re not actively using them. Additionally, you can turn off auto-sync for apps that don’t need constant updates, such as email or social media, to save even more power.
